Output eaae46bc676c6efe002248338ac67e7573055beddffa32857230a53aa31e81ef:2

value
6702426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d068f1f1b923bbfab904b77c39b2f341689c3e56 OP_EQUAL
address
3LgzCA63qBsmC4j4HbUeHnoSZt3b7d6mNm
transaction
eaae46bc676c6efe002248338ac67e7573055beddffa32857230a53aa31e81ef
confirmations
178056
spent
true